The concept of Hanfu dates back to the ancient times, when it was worn by the Han people as their traditional attire. Over centuries, it has evolved and transformed, adopting various styles and designs. Today's Hanfu fashion is a blend of ancient tradition and modern elements, making it appealing to a wide range of people, including those who are not of Han ethnicity.
Blue Hanfu, in particular, has become a popular choice among fashion enthusiasts. The color blue is deeply associated with traditional Chinese culture, symbolizing peace, tranquility, and harmony. When combined with the elegance and sophistication of Hanfu design, blue creates a stunning visual impact that is both classic and modern.

The design elements of blue Hanfu are intricate and fascinating. The use of different shades of blue creates a rich visual experience. From deep navy blue to light azure, each shade offers a unique aesthetic. The intricate patterns and designs, often featuring Chinese cultural symbols like dragons, phoenixes, clouds, and flowers, add to its charm and allure.
